If n is a positive integer and n^2 is divisible by 72, then the largest positive integer that must divide n is

a. 6
b. 12
c. 24
d. 36
e. 48

by selango » Sat Jun 26, 2010 6:22 am
mitzwillrockgmat,

Method1
---------------------

Split 72 according to prime factorization,

72=2*2*2*3*3

Since n is a perfect square,make the factors as the perfect square.

How can we make them as perfect square?

By multiplying 2 with the factors.[remember n is multiple of 72]

72=2*2*2*2*3*3

So n^2 is divisible 2*2*2*2*3*3

Take each common factor.2*2*3

Hence 12.

Method 2
-----------------------------------------------------


n^2 is divisible by 72

n^2=72q+r[q is quotient r=0]

n^2=72q

n^2=2^3*3^2*q

n^2=2^4*3^2*q[multiply by 2]

n^2=12*12*q

So 12 is the highest positive integer that divides n^2

Hope this clarifies.
